<p>And as I was reading about <a href="http://socialmediaguerilla.com/social-media-marketing/is-your-company-stuck-with-a-social-media-silo/" target="_blank">Social Media Silos</a>, it struck me that most companies flush their social media marketing down the drain by failing to integrate departments and make them communicate.</p>
<p>A silly mistake that can cost thousands of dollars and waste considerable time, silos are the result of a poorly constructed social strategy. Companies that see a blog as another billboard are doomed.</p>
